What Defines a Reliable Online Casino?
Trust is built through visible information rather than attractive graphics alone. A credible operator normally displays its licensing details, terms and conditions, privacy policy, support channels and rules for bonuses. These pages should be easy to find and written clearly enough for players to understand important restrictions.
- Check the regulator and licence details before creating an account.
- Review deposit, withdrawal and identity-verification requirements.
- Confirm that the games come from established software providers.
- Look for encrypted connections and secure account controls.
- Test customer support before depositing, especially outside standard hours.
Independent reviews can help with initial research, but they should complement rather than replace direct checks. A strong reputation is valuable, yet the current terms published on the casino website remain the final reference point for eligibility, wagering conditions and payment processing.
Comparing Bonuses Beyond the Headline Figure
A large welcome offer may appear appealing, although the headline amount rarely tells the whole story. Wagering requirements, maximum bet limits, game contribution percentages and withdrawal caps can significantly change the practical value of a promotion.
| Promotion detail | Why it matters |
|---|---|
| Wagering requirement | Shows how many times qualifying funds must be played through. |
| Game contribution | Explains whether slots, roulette or blackjack count fully toward turnover. |
| Maximum bet | Sets the highest permitted stake while bonus funds are active. |
| Expiry period | Defines how long the player has to complete the promotion. |
| Withdrawal restrictions | Identifies limits, excluded funds or verification conditions. |
Players should calculate the total commitment before accepting an offer. A smaller promotion with transparent conditions may be more useful than a larger reward attached to an aggressive wagering target. Promotions should be viewed as optional extras, not as a reason to increase a planned budget.
Choosing Games With Better Information
Game selection influences both entertainment value and bankroll duration. Slots are easy to access and offer varied themes, but their volatility can differ widely. A high-volatility title may deliver larger occasional wins while producing longer stretches without a significant return. Lower-volatility games often provide smaller, more frequent results, although no format guarantees profit.
Useful Details to Compare
- Return to player, presented as a long-term theoretical percentage.
- Volatility, describing how frequently and dramatically outcomes may vary.
- Paytable rules, including wild symbols, bonus rounds and winning combinations.
- Maximum win limits, particularly on promotional or jackpot titles.
- Live game limits, table speed and the available range of betting options.
RTP is a statistical measure across many rounds, not a forecast for one session. Past results do not influence future spins, cards or roulette outcomes. Understanding this distinction helps prevent the common mistake of chasing losses because a game appears “due” to produce a win.
Managing Payments and Account Security
Payment convenience should be balanced with control. Players benefit from methods that provide clear transaction records, realistic processing times and appropriate security. Before depositing, check the minimum and maximum limits, fees, supported currencies and whether withdrawals must return to the original payment method.
Account protection also deserves attention. Use a unique password, enable two-factor authentication where available and avoid logging in through unknown links or public devices. Verification requests are normal for regulated operators, but sensitive documents should only be submitted through the casino’s secure account area.
Responsible Play as Part of the Strategy
A sustainable casino routine begins with a fixed entertainment budget. That amount should be money a player can afford to lose without affecting rent, bills, savings or other obligations. Time limits are equally useful because extended sessions can make decisions less deliberate, especially after a sequence of losses.
- Set deposit, loss and session limits before playing.
- Never borrow money to continue gambling.
- Take breaks and avoid play when tired, upset or under the influence.
- Do not treat gambling as a method of earning income.
- Use cooling-off or self-exclusion tools if control becomes difficult.
Responsible gaming tools are strongest when used early, before spending begins to feel uncomfortable. A well-chosen operator should make these controls visible, simple to activate and available without pressure to continue playing.
